
Palakkad to Diu
Diu is approximately 1300+ kms from Palakkad. The fastest way to reach Diu from Palakkad is by Bus, Flight Via Coimbatore, Mumbai. It takes approximately 7 hours. The cheapest way to reach Diu from Palakkad is by Train, Bus Via Vapi which would take approximately 34 hours.
Sort By
Mode of Transport
Via Coimbatore, Mumbai
RECOMMENDED
Palakkad
Coimbatore
Mumbai
Diu
Approx Travel Time
7h 7m
₹12,935
Onwards
Palakkad
Coimbatore
Mumbai
Diu
Approx Travel Time
6h 52m
₹10,647
Onwards
FASTEST
Palakkad
Coimbatore
Mumbai
Diu
Approx Travel Time
6h 50m
₹11,362
Onwards
Via Vapi
CHEAPEST
Palakkad
Vapi
Diu
Approx Travel Time
1d 9h 36m
₹2,725
Onwards
Via Bangalore, Surat
Palakkad
Bangalore
Surat
Diu
Approx Travel Time
1d 16h 20m
₹3,979
Onwards
Via Calicut, Mumbai
Palakkad
Calicut
Mumbai
Diu
Approx Travel Time
8h 16m
₹14,523
Onwards
Palakkad
Calicut
Mumbai
Diu
Approx Travel Time
7h 37m
₹10,603
Onwards
Palakkad
Calicut
Mumbai
Diu
Approx Travel Time
7h 45m
₹11,238
Onwards
Via Cochin, Mumbai
Palakkad
Cochin
Mumbai
Diu
Approx Travel Time
8h 2m
₹13,431
Onwards
Via Kannur, Mumbai
Palakkad
Kannur
Mumbai
Diu
Approx Travel Time
9h 5m
₹11,003
Onwards
Frequently Asked Questions
What is the distance between Palakkad and Diu?
Diu is approximately 1300+ kms from Palakkad.
How long does it take to reach Diu from Palakkad?
It takes approximately 7 hours to reach Diu from Palakkad by Bus, Flight Via Coimbatore, Mumbai.
What is the cheapest way to reach Diu from Palakkad?
The cheapest way to reach Diu from Palakkad is by Train, Bus Via Vapi.
What is the fastest way to reach Diu from Palakkad?
The fastest way to reach Diu from Palakkad is by Bus, Flight Via Coimbatore, Mumbai.


